Total Quality Management (TQM): Training Module on "Problem Solving."
Leigh, David
This module for a 1-semester Total Quality Management (TQM) course for high school or community college students contains a brief overview of problem solving and offers a practical approach along with some of the tools that can be used. The following components are included: (1) narrative of the problem-solving process; (2) the problem-solving process, using the Shewhart Cycle, the Joiner model, and the Xerox model; (3) problem-solving tools, including tools for generating ideas and collecting information, tools for reaching consensus, tools for analyzing and displaying data, and tools for planning actions; and (4) a problem-solving example using an algebra class. Handouts and transparency masters are included. (KC)
